一、术语session 在我的经验里,session这个词被滥用的程度大概仅次于transaction,更加有趣的是transaction与session在某些语境下的含义是相同的。 session,中文经常翻译为会话,其本来的含义是指有始有终的一系列动作/消息,比如打电话时从拿起电话拨号到挂断电话这中间的一系列过程可以称之 为一个session。有时候我们可以看到这样的话“在一个浏览器会
一、术语session在我的经验里,session这个词被滥用的程度大概仅次于transaction,更加有趣的是transaction与session在某些语境下的含义是相同的。session,中文经常翻译为会话,其本来的含义是指有始有终的一系列动作/消息,比如打电话时从拿起电话拨号到挂断电话这中间的一系列过程可以称之为一个session。有时候我们可以看到这样的话“在一个浏览器会话期间,...
1.session的简单介绍session是一种保存上下文信息的机制,保存的是对象,它的值是存放在服务器端,它通过sessionId来区分不同
原创
2023-06-01 17:27:13
65阅读
摘要:虽然session机制在web应用程序中被采用已经很长时间了,但是仍然有很多人不清楚session机制的本质,以至不能正确的应用这一技术。本文将详细讨论session的工作机制并且对在Java web application中应用session机制时常见的问题作出解答。目录:一、术语session二、HTTP协议与状态保持三、理解cookie机制四、理解session机制
转载
精选
2015-11-30 16:11:00
236阅读
摘要:虽然session机制在web应用程序中被采用已经很长时间了,但是仍然有很多人不清楚session机制的本质,以至不能正确的应用这一技术。本文将详细讨论session的工作机制并且对在Java web application中应用session机制时常见的问题作出解答。
目录:
一、术语session
二、HTTP协议与状态保持
三、理解cooki
转载
精选
2012-09-06 11:39:59
258阅读
session介绍 在WEB开发中,服务器可以为每个用户浏览器创建一个会话对象(session对象),注意:一个浏览器独占一个session对象(默认情况下)。因此,在需要保存用户数据时,服务器程序可以把用户数据写到用户浏览器独占的session中,当用户使用浏览器访问其它程序时,其它程序可以从用户 ...
转载
2021-04-24 11:49:00
165阅读
2评论
Session的讲解昨天我们讲解了Cookie的原理及应用,那么我们今天来讲解一下Session。首先我们先来说一下什么是session:我们在使用Cookie和附加URL参数来传递上一次请求状态信息时,如果传递的状态信息较多时将会极大降低网络传输效率和增大服务器端程序处理的难度。这时我们就可以用Session技术。Session技术是一种将会话状态保存在服务器端的技术,客户端需要接收、记忆和回送
”协议,即为无状态协议。无状态协议是指协议对务处理没有记忆能力。缺少状态意味着如果后续处理需要前面的信息,则它必须重传,这样可能导致每次连接传送的数据量增大。另一方面,在服务器不需要先前信息时它的应答就较快。 http协议不像建立了socket连接的两个终端,双方是可以互相通信的,http的客户端只能通过
原创
2022-09-29 06:53:10
42阅读
Session机制详细介绍
原创
2022-05-08 17:12:40
103阅读
简而言之,session 和 cookie就是一个能存放信息的容器,具有持续性,二者的区别在于两个地方:1.session都存放在服务器端,cookie存放在用户各自的客户端(浏览器)2.session可以存放对象,而cookie只能存放文本信息且大小限制4k,理论上session存放的大小和服务的存储能力是一致的。二者都有时效性,即所谓的生命周期,这里不做展开,说明具有持续性即可,
原创
2015-11-13 12:43:22
252阅读
Tomcat利用MSM实现Session共享方案解说 Session共享有多种解决方法,常用的有四种:1)客户端Cookie保存2)服务器间Session同步3)使用集群管理Session(如MSM)4)把Session持久化到数据库针对上面Session共享四种方法的详解:1)客户端Cookie保存以cookie加密的方式保存在客户端.优点是减轻服务器端的压力,每次session信息被写在客服端
原创
2020-06-29 21:55:04
904阅读
文章目录1. Session1.1.PHP Session 变量1.1.PHP使用Session使用session存储 Session 变量终结 Session1. Session由于 Cookie 是服务端下发给客户端由客户端本地保存的。换而言之客户端可以在本地对其随意操作,包括删除和修改。如果客户端随意伪造一个 Cookie 的话,对于服务端是无法辨别的,就会造成服务端被蒙蔽,构成安全隐患。于是乎就有了另外一种基于 Cookie 基础之上的手段:Session:Session 区别于 Cooki
原创
2021-01-23 23:23:10
292阅读
session&cooikes名称解释cooikes在计算机中是指一种能够让网站服务器把少量数据存储到客户端的硬盘或者文件内。重点是存放在客户端的一个键值对。好处:是互联网的网网络使用起来更方便了一些。坏处:由于是明文存在于客户端,安全性不好。session是存在于服务器上一个数据。作用是用来验证和保持会话,它是依赖cooikes的。案例分析学习通过设计一个网站登陆跳转的页面来分析下ses
原创
2018-02-28 16:33:28
1339阅读
本篇主要讲解Python Requests模块session的使用建议及整个会话中的所有cookie的方法。测试代码服务端:下面是用flask做的一个服务端,用来设置cookie以及打印请求时的请求头。# -*- coding: utf-8 -*-
from flask import Flask, make_response, request
app = Flask(__name__)
@a
Session对象是HttpSessionState的一个实例。该类为当前用户会话提供信息,还提供对可用于存储信息会话范围的缓存的访问,以及控制如何管理会话的方法。下面介绍设置session失效的几种方法。
在系统登录后,都会设置一个当前session失效的时间,以确保在用户长时间不与服务器交互,自动退出登录,销毁session。
具体设置很简单,方法有三种:
(1)在主页面
转载
精选
2012-07-11 11:03:59
479阅读
Session中文是“会话”的意思,在ASP.NET中代表了服务器与客户端之间的“会话”。Session的作用时间从用户到达某个特定的Web页开始,到该用户离开Web站点,或在程序中利用代码终止某个Session结束。引用Session 则可以让一个用户访问多个页面之间的切换也会保留该用户的信息。Session模型简介 在学习之前我们会疑惑,Session是什么呢?简单来说就是服务器给客
转载
2021-05-05 21:30:28
1305阅读
2评论
前言 由于http协议是无状态协议,它并不储存关于客户的状态信息,就像服务器会完全忘记之前发生的事情一样。 然而在实际的使用中,当你登录某个购物网站时,你的购物车里的东西会一直保存下来,当你登录一些视频 网站时,它会根据你过去的喜好给你推送类似的视频。实现这些功能,就涉及到了cookie和sessi ...
转载
2021-06-16 23:12:29
165阅读
今天小婷儿给大家分享的是flask中cookie和session介绍。flask中cookie和session介绍
flask中cookie和session介绍 一、cookie:在网站中,http请求是无状态的。也就是说即使第一次和服务器连接后并且登录成功后,第二次请求服务器依然不能知道当前请求是哪个用户。cookie的出现就是为了解决这个问题,第一
原创
2021-04-18 11:05:35
193阅读
█Redis介绍●redis是一个key-value存储系统。和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。与memcached一样,为了保证效率,数据都是缓存在内存中。区别的是redis会周期性的把更新的数据写入磁盘或者把修改操作写入追加的记录文件,
原创
2017-07-04 11:48:30
7383阅读
flask中cookie和session介绍 一、cookie:在网站中,http请求是无状态的。也就是说即使第一次和服务器连接后并且登录成功后,第二次请求服务器依然不能知道当前请求是哪个用户。cookie的出现就是为了解决这个问题,第一次登录后服务器返回一些数据(cookie)给浏览器,然后浏览器保存在本地,当该用户发送第二次请求的时候,就会自动的把上次请求存储的cookie数据自动的携带给服务
原创
2021-04-18 16:38:16
191阅读